October 26, 2004 (Press Release) -- NextWest, Inc. announced today that the NextContact Call Center Solution has been named a ”Best of Show” winner at Technology Marketing Corporation (TMC)’s INTERNET TELEPHONY® Conference and EXPO Fall 2004. The show, held last month at the Millennium Biltmore Hotel in Los Angeles, is widely considered the #1 global event focused on VoIP.

NextContact is a completely integrated, single-source solution for inbound, outbound and blended contact centers.

Features include Skills-Based Routing, PBX, VoIP, Advanced ACD, IVR, E-mail, Fax-on-Demand, Predictive Dialing and more; all in one system. Finally, there is no need to deal with complex, multi-vendor integration for a complete contact center solution.

About NextWest

NextWest, Inc.is a leading manufacturer of IP-based business telecommunications and contact center systems. Our rock-solid, fully-integrated, IP and converged communications systems are helping small to mid-sized businesses, government agencies and other institutions to meet their growing telecommunications needs.
